October 21, the Kiwanis Club of Northern Door will present the second program of their “Travel and Adventure Film Season.” The event will be presented by internationally-recognized travel lecturer and cinematographer, John Holod, who will share the adventure of a lifetime with The Great Rocky Mountain RV Adventure – Part 2.
From Glacier National Park, Montana to Jasper, Alberta in the spectacular Canadian Rockies, the film will meander along the back roads across some of the most beautiful scenery in the world, exploring both familiar and not so familiar natural wonders along the way. Filmed in beautiful high-definition wide-screen format, video highlights include Glacier National Park, Kootenay National Park, Yoho National Park, Jasper National Park, and more.
Holod will be joined by co-producer of John Holod Productions, Jodi Ginter.
The program will begin at 7:30 pm at the First Baptist Church in Sister Bay. Admission is $7 or $36 for a six-ticket season pass that is valid for admission to any of the season’s remaining travel films.
